Responsibilities


Role SummaryThe Director of Renewals owns the global renewals and retention strategy across 8 Idera brands, leading brand managers and renewal representatives to consistently exceed renewal, retention, and expansion targets. This role is highly visible and partners closely with executive leadership, Sales, Finance, Product, Legal, and Customer Success. You will be accountable for forecasting accuracy, renewal execution, retention analysis, and proactive risk mitigation while motivating and developing high-performing teams.
